What is the safest airline in Thailand?

Thai Airways and subsidiary Thai Smile remain the highest scoring airline for safety in Thailand with a score of 4/7. Following this is Thai Orient and Bangkok air on three stars and on just two stars, Nok Air and AirAsia Thailand.

What month should you avoid Thailand?

When to avoid traveling in Thailand

Chiang Mai: If possible, avoid visiting from mid-February through early April . This is “burning season” and air quality can be quite bad. Similan Islands: The National Marine Park is closed between the months of November through March.

How much should I budget for a trip to Thailand?

You should plan to spend around ฿3,241 ($99) per day on your vacation in Thailand, which is the average daily price based on the expenses of other visitors. Past travelers have spent, on average, ฿481 ($15) on meals for one day and ฿384 ($12) on local transportation.

Is Thai Airways a good airline?

Thai Airways is Certified as a 4-Star Airline for the quality of its airport and onboard product and staff service . Product rating includes seats, amenities, food & beverages, IFE, cleanliness etc, and service rating is for both cabin staff and ground staff.

What is the difference between Thai Airways and Thai Smile?

Thai Smile Airways (Thai: ไทยสมายล์แอร์เวย์) is a Thai regional airline. It began operations in 2012 and is a wholly owned subsidiary of Thai Airways.
